How to Become a Heavy Duty Mechanic

If you want to become a heavy duty mechanic, you will need to complete a formal education program. Generally, this is a three-to-five-year apprenticeship that includes on-the-job training and technical school, which will give you the skills necessary to earn a journeyperson certificate from the relevant government agency.

Employers prefer applicants with formal training, since this will give you the knowledge and experience that they look for when hiring technicians. You will also have the opportunity to learn about the latest technology and techniques that are being used in this field.

You will also learn about diesel engine technologies and fuel systems, which is an increasingly important part of the industry. In addition, you will study electrical and electronic components in heavy vehicles and equipment.

Formal education can also help you increase your chances of a high-paying job. While you can get an entry-level position with a high school diploma and some on-the-job training, employers typically prefer applicants who have completed an associate or bachelor’s degree in heavy equipment mechanics.

Getting an internship is another great way to prepare for a career as a heavy duty mechanic. An internship gives you the opportunity to practice your skills with different types of heavy equipment, which can help you decide what kind of career you want.

How to Become a Diesel Mechanic

If you are looking for a career that offers long hours, a lot of responsibility and the potential to earn significant income, becoming a diesel mechanic might be right for you. This is because these types of jobs require a high level of skill and expertise, and many diesel technicians are in high demand.

You can get a career as a diesel mechanic by earning an associate or bachelor’s degree in this field, which will give you the knowledge and skills that employers are looking for when hiring technicians. You will learn about diesel engines, power shift transmissions, hydraulics and electronics.
